Varnika Kundu stalking accused, out on bail, appointed Haryana's Assistant Advocate General

Vikas Barala spent around five months in jail but continued to pursue his law education during that time. The case is still being heard in a lower court in Chandigarh.

Vikas Barala, the son of former Haryana BJP chief Subhash Barala, has been appointed as a law officer by the Haryana government with advocate general (AG) office, even as he continues to face trial in the high-profile 2017 Varnika Kundu stalking case, Hindustan Times reported.

His name is part of a list of over 100 new appointments notified by the state government on July 18, where he has been given the role of Assistant Advocate General at the Advocate General’s Delhi office.

The case that grabbed national headlines

The appointment has sparked attention because Barala is still undergoing trial in a case that had once grabbed national headlines.
